Midori is a comprehensive Japanese-English, English-Japanese dictionary. It's a perfect tool for Japanese learners, with 910,000 entries, 150,000 example sentences, and numerous features designed to enhance your Japanese learning experience.DICTIONARY ENTRIES• More than 190,000 word entries. Each entry shows readings, meanings, and a kanji breakdown.• More than 12,000 kanji entries. Each entry shows readings, meanings, and example compounds.• Example sentences with furigana (small hiragana above kanji)• Over 6,000 kanji with stroke order diagrams and stroke order animations• Over 730,000 Japanese proper names, place names, given names, company names and product names• Japanese pitch accentSEARCH & TRANSLATE• Search words by using kana or romaji, such as あき or aki• Search words by capturing a photo. (Note: Only horizontal text is supported.)• Search kanji by drawing them• Search kanji by combining radicals, e.g. 禾 + 火 -> 秋• Search suggestion when the input is in a conjugated form, e.g. 走った -> 走る• Search with wildcard characters, e.g. 日*人 returns all words that start with 日 and end with 人• Search with the SKIP system• Partial results when the full word is not found, e.g. searching for 青い本 returns the results for 青い and 本• Fast incremental search gives you the result instantly as you typeLISTS & BOOKMARKS• List of kanji as taught in Japanese schools from grade 1 to 6• List of kanji by frequency as appeared in Japanese newspapers• List of kanji and words by Japanese Language Proficiency Test (JLPT) levels• Lists of hiragana and katakana, each with stroke diagram and animation• Bookmarks with folders support. You can export, import, or share bookmarks with your friends.OTHER FEATURES• Flashcards for bookmarked words and kanji• Audio pronunciations (via speech synthesis)• Create a vocabulary list with definitions from Japanese text in one tap• Scratch pad for practicing writing kanji on iPad• No internet connection
